Output d7e0c27d2591e3d7ab9feb6140bc3e64ec06f9db88bbb38c7caf2c7b6c573353:0

value
2129554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4baaf1658b45e8291b278c01dcad73a65b81a1ee OP_EQUAL
address
38b7PFnqDckRth8YHFEPaiekJk2Lf2B1t7
transaction
d7e0c27d2591e3d7ab9feb6140bc3e64ec06f9db88bbb38c7caf2c7b6c573353
spent
true